Red O Restaurant Mexican Cuisine by Rick Bayless features authentic Mexican cuisine as well as lighter California-style dishes. Named one of America’s “Best New Restaurant’s” with the “Best Design” by Esquire magazine in 2010. Chef Rick Bayless Most people know him from winning the title of Bravo’s Top Chef Master, beating out the French and Italian chef’s with his authentic Mexican cuisine. His highly rated on going series, Mexico-One Plate at a Time can be found on tv sets coast to coast, as well as his award winning six cookbooks. Chef Bayless’ second book, Mexican Kitchen won the Julia Childs IACP cookbook other the year award in 1996, and his fourth book, Mexico-One Plate at a Time, won The James Beard Best International Cookbook of the year award in 2001. His side by side award-winning other restaurants in Chicago were founded in 1987: the casual Frontera Grill and the 4-star Topolobampo. In 2007, Frontera Grill won for Outstanding Restaurant by the James Beard Organization. His award-winning Frontera line of salsas, grilling sauces and organic chips can be found coast to coast. On the local front, Rick and his staff began the Frontera Farmer Foundation in 2003 to attract support for small Midwestern farms. Each year grants are given to local farmers for capital improvements to their local farms. In 2007 he was awarded the Humanitarian of the Year by the International Association of Culinary Professionals for his work with local farmers. Chef Bayless and his team also launched Frontera Scholarship: a full tuition scholarship that will send a Mexican American student to Kendall Culinary College to study culinary arts. Rick Bayless has won James Beard awards for: Midwest Chef of the Year, National Chef of the Year, and Humanitarian of the Year
